    On my Qu16 I’ve noticed recently that when I place some effects on vocals using FX1 or FX2, they seem fine in a sound check and then after a couple tunes the effects diminish greatly. Adjusting the fader doesn’t help at all, effects only project slightly, then all of sudden a few minutes later they come back without doing anything. We did a gig last Saturday night and everything was great in sound check and our singer really liked the amount of effects on his voice. We played a few songs in sound check and all of sudden he turned to me and said the effects are gone, and no one touched a thing. I slid the fader up and that was the best I could get although overall it was very slight. We started the show and part way thru the first song the effects came back with a vengeance and since we do our own sound I could not adjust it down until the song ended (I’m the drummer and run sound) Any ideas from anyone on what could be going on??

    I can remember doing an outside event many years ago with my QU-16 for a band and what you are describing happened to me. One minute the vocal reverb was on, the next it just vanished and nothing I could do to bring it back. So I hastily setup another reverb via FX2 which worked until the end of the show. I set my desk up the day after at home and the reverb still didn’t work on FX1, I reset the desk and it has never done that since.

    I had the same thing happen very early on when I purchased my QU-16 around 2013 to one particular scene set up. I was never able to get the effects on that one scene to work correctly so I programmed a new scene and never had the same issue again on any of the dozens of scenes I have saved.
